Ann "Nancy" Graham 1827 – 1899 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 16 Dec 1827

Birth Location: Southend, Argyll, Scotland

Death Date: 19 Jun 1899

Death Location: Ekfrid, Middlesex, Ontario, Canada

Father: Duncan Graham

Mother: Katherine McKerral

Spouse(s): John Graham

Children(s): John Graham, Flora Graham, Duncan Graham

The story of Ann "Nancy" Graham began in 1827 in Southend, Argyll, Scotland. Ann "Nancy" Graham married John (Crossroad) Graham, and had children including John (Crossroad Jack) Graham, Flora Graham, Duncan Graham. Ann "Nancy" Graham passed away in 1899 in Ekfrid, Middlesex, Ontario, Canada.
